The St. Patrick's Day Quiz!

I love St. Patrick's Day. I like having a holiday with my name in it for one thing, and it's my dad's birthday, but I also love it because I am a big fan of St. Patrick. More on that later this week. First, test your knowledge of all things St. Patrick!

1. What country was Patrick born in?
A.France
B.Britain
C.Italy
D.Germany

2. What were the circumstances of Patrick’s first visit to Ireland?
A.He was banished there by his father, a British tribal king
B.His ship wrecked there, and he was rescued by Irish fishermen
C.He was ordered to go there as a missionary by Pope Boniface III
D.He was kidnapped by pirates and taken as a slave

3. St. Patrick’s Day is the traditional day of his:
A.Birth
B.Death
C.Conversion
D.Ascension to the bishopric

4. Which of the following does Patrick not confess to in his “Confession?”
A.Baptizing thousands of people
B.Not believing in God before he became a slave
C.Having a concubine as a young man
D.Committing as a missionary to Ireland due to a vision

5. Besides his confession, the only other surviving work by Patrick is a letter to British bishops urging the excommunication of a British king named Coroticus. Why did Patrick want him excommunicated?
A. His soldiers committed human sacrifice
B. He urged a different date for the celebration of Easter
C. He encouraged his followers to celebrate pagan holy days
D. His soldiers kidnapped and made slaves of some of Patrick’s converts

6. What is “St. Patrick’s Breastplate?”
A. An ancient Irish poem/prayer attributed to Patrick
B. A piece of ancient armor traditionally worn by Christian Celtic kings
C. A cliff near Patrick’s burial place, named for its distinctive shape
D. A shield on which the story of Patrick is inscribed

7. Which of the following is not attributed to Patrick in Irish legend?
A.Banishing snakes from Ireland
B.Using the shamrock to teach about the Trinity
C.Blessing the water-plantain so it could be used to drive off fairies
D.Killing the Basilisk (the chicken-headed serpent who killed with a gaze!)
E.Driving out the dragon Ollipheist

8. Patrick is NOT the patron saint of which of the following?
A.Ireland
B.Freed slaves
C.Engineers
D.Boston
E.Nigeria

9. True or false: Patrick has never been canonized (declared a saint) by a Pope.

10. Which of the following was not born of St. Patrick’s day?
A.Kurt Russell
B.Rob Lowe
C.James Madison
D.Nat King Cole



Answers: 1 -B, 2 -D, 3 -B, 4 -C (that was Augustine's confession), 5 -D (for obvious reasons, Patrick wasn't a big fan of slavery), 6 -A (more on this later), 7 -D, 8 -B, 9 - True (back in the day, saints were canonized regionally),10 - C (March 16, ha!)
